[O Men!] Are you more difficult to create than the heaven which He has built, 27 and raised its vault high and proportioned it; 28 Gave darkness to its night, and brightness to its day; 29 and the earth-after that He spread it out, 30 And he brought forth therefrom its water, and its pasture. 31 and has made the mountains firm: 32 (To be) a provision and benefit for you and your cattle. 33 When the great calamity comes, 34 the Day when the human will remember what he has worked for, 35 And hell will stand forth visible to him who seeth, 36 So for one who rebelled, 37 And preferred the life of the world, 38 Verily the Scorch! that shall be his resort. 39 But as for him who feared standing before his Lord, and restrained himself from impure evil desires, and lusts. 40 Their abode will be the Garden. 41 They ask thee about the Hour,-'When will be its appointed time? 42 You have no knowledge to say anything about it, 43 Towards your Lord only is its conclusion. 44 Thou art but a Warner for such as fear it. 45 On the day when they see it, it will seem to them as though they had only lived in the world for a morning and an afternoon. 46
